Web2 de out. de 2024 · Making oobleck is a great science experiment to show how changes in pressure can change the properties of some materials. Sort of like how temperature changes the properties of water. Cold or freezing temperatures turns water into ice. Whereas warm temperatures melts ice and turns it into a liquid. Web*Note: Oobleck is non-toxic, but use caution when doing any science activity. Be careful not to get it in your eyes, and wash your hands after handling the Oobleck. Directions 1. Ask student to create a testable question (a hypothesis). 2. Example: Will objects sink or float in the oobleck? 3. Put 1 cup of water in a bowl and gradually add the ...
